To protect workbook structure, you need to go to the protect structure and window dialog. When expanding the vba project, the user is presented with a box to enter the password. The following vba code snippets will be useful for applying this post in a wider context. How to unprotect excel workbook and worksheet with or without. Recover a forgotten protect workbook structure password. Newer protection is based on encryption which cannot be easily removed. I cant unprotect my excel worksheet even though i have. My vba code that someone helped me write im learningtransfers the data from the input form to the database, but it wont do it with the worksheetworkbook protection on. Dim i as integer, j as integer, k as integer dim l as integer, m as integer, n as integer dim i1 as integer, i2 as integer, i3 as integer dim i4 as integer, i5 as. Unlock excel spreadsheet with vba code for excel 2010 and lower. Here is the syntax to unprotect workbook using vba. While opening it will ask you to enter the password. Its a good idea to keep a list of your passwords and their corresponding document names in a safe place. We can use unprotect method and iterate all the worksheets in a workbook.
I am not sure if there is a way to enable it but even vba doesnt work. I created the file and protected the workbook structure. Public sub excelprotectioncracker breaks worksheet and workbook structure protection. In this post, we will consider protecting and unprotecting workbooks. Note you can only unprotect one single excel sheet by using vba code. When a workbook is protected, users will be unable to add, delete, hide unhide, or protect unprotect worksheets. Get answers from your peers along with millions of it pros who visit spiceworks. Protect and unprotect worksheets in excel vba analysistabs. Unprotect excel workbook top methods with step by step guide. If the vba codes on above dont work for you, get help with cocosenor workbook unprotect tuner which can help you to unprotect excel workbook structure protection in a few minutes.
How to protectunprotect workbook structure and windows. Create a button on the sheet and on click event call the macro excelprotectioncracker. Sub passwordbreaker breaks worksheet password protection. Vba unprotect sheet use vba code to unprotect excel sheet. Have questions or feedback about office vba or this. This method has no effect if the sheet or workbook isnt protected. Unprotectprotect workbook structure hey everyone, i am using 2 sheets to balance confidential data. Apr 11, 2020 the vba project project properties window opens. Unprotect yourpassword, true, true end sub in the above example we are unprotecting the workbook by using unprotect method of workbook object in the active workbook. If this argument is omitted, you can unprotect the worksheet or workbook without using a password. Unprotect excel sheet remove excel password in 5 mins. Protect sheets in excel 20 or 2016, use the workbook in excel 20072010, but do not unprotect or protect these sheets again in any version earlier than 20.
Review tab protect workbook enter password click ok. Note that in excel 20, the windows box is disabled. Select the protection tab, tick the lock project for viewing, enter and confirm a password, then click ok. Protect and unprotect excel workbook using vba analysistabs. Verify your account to enable it peers to see that you are a professional. Open the zipped file and extract the relevant xml file from the zipped file. True end sub sub protectionoff for each sht in activeworkbook. Excel allows you the ability to protect your excel workbooks from changes.
Protect the workbook structure to prevent other people from adding. If you forgot the password to unprotect excel 20 workbook, vba code is another method you can attempt to use. How to protect and unprotect excel sheet with or without. If you need to unprotect all sheets, you have to run the vba code over and over again.
When we open the excel then we have to enter password to unprotect the sheet. Still remember excel workbook structure protected password 1. Run the macro to unprotect the worksheet, and then save the workbook back as an. In addition, when i click the end button, it lets me into the workbook, but protect worksheet and protect workbook are greyed out and i can edit all cells, even those i have protected. Method 1 excel 2007 cannot use this method, please go to method 2 click file info protect workbook protect workbook structure. How to unprotect excel sheet workbook with vba codes as you have read, it is very easy to unprotect excel sheet using a thirdparty tool like excel password recovery but there are also other efficient methods available that you can implement on your locked excel document. In this article, we will show you the way to unprotect the sheet using vba coding. How to unprotect excel sheet without password amarindaz. This tutorial provides one excel method that can be applied to unprotect a workbook. If you want to delete the restrictions of all worksheets, we can unprotect all worksheets at a time. Otherwise, you must specify the password to unprotect the worksheet or workbook. Microsoft excel offers the option protect sheet to protect each sheet with a password, but unfortunately it doesnt prevent users from deleting the sheet.
On unprotect workbook dialog, enter the password you know and click ok to unprotect workbook structure and windows. How to unprotect workbooks or bypass protection youtube. If want to unprotect excel workbook structure, follow the 2 ways below. When you set a password to protect your workbook, you may choose password or structure option. Userinterfaceonly argument is an optional argument in the protect method and its default is false. Jan 10, 20 unprotect or remove password or hack any excel worksheets 2003 2007 2010. How to protect and unprotect workbook structure and windows. If you forget the password, you cannot unprotect the sheet or workbook. Unprotect workbook method vba explained with examples. A string that specifies a casesensitive password for the worksheet or workbook. Jun 14, 2017 if want to unprotect excel workbook structure, follow the 2 ways below.
As is known, workbook protection password should be removed if we want to unprotect workbook structure and windows. Vba workbook protection password protect unprotect automate. How to unprotect excel worksheet, in 5 simple steps. Have questions or feedback about office vba or this documentation. Youll know how to do that by following the below steps. If you are building a model, you probably want to turn on workbook protection to prevent users or you. Dont forget to set the vba project properties to lock project for viewing or users will be able to seechange the password. To view this option, click file info protect workbook. In order to make changes to the structure of a protected not encrypted workbook, you need to unlock it first. Please see office vba support and feedback for guidance about the ways you can receive support and provide feedback.
While protecting the worksheet we usually maintain the same password. This tutorial shows how to unprotect a workbook which will all users to insert, delete, rename, copy, move, color, hide and unhide worksheets by using excel or vba. You may want to unprotect workbook in excel vba when you feel its not. The protect workbook option in the info menu also indicates that the workbook s structure is protected. Feb 01, 2011 you can call this macro from some other macro if u dont want to go to vba and run it. I dont have access to winrar or any other programs as i do not have access to download anything. The debug button is greyed out, and the help button doesnt come up with anything. So another option protect workbook is usually used when we want to protect excel sheet, which will not allow others to insert, delete, rename, move, copy, hide or. Vba workbook protection password protect unprotect. Please find the below example, it will show you how to unprotect the workbook. Vba code to protect and unprotect workbooks excel off the grid. Unprotect excel workbook 202016 with or without password. Unlock protected excel workbook with or without password. Protect password, structure, windows expression a variable that represents a workbook object.
I cant unprotect my excel worksheet even though i have the right password i have a protected workbook that i protected myself, i have to enter the password just to open it and it opens fine. Once the workbook is protected with a password, to unprotect we need to remember the exact password that we have entered while protecting the workbook. I have a popular vba code to unprotect a worksheet, but i am still running into the issue that the workbook is protected. Unprotect or remove password or hack any excel worksheets 2003 2007 2010. Another method is renaming the filename extension of your spreadsheet to. Show message box if the structure is protected if thisworkbook. Following is the example code will show you how to unprotect all worksheets in workbook using vba. If you forget the password, you cannot unprotect the worksheet or workbook. Excel unprotect workbook and worksheets using vba tar solutions. Id like to add code to unprotect the worksheets and workbook prior to transferring the data to the database, and then reprotect the worksheetsworkbooks. The vba code methods above will work for both mdi and sdi in. How to unprotect excel workbooksheet without password 2016.
Follow the below steps to unprotect the protected workbook in excel. Unprotect workbook structure and windows without password. I need to unlock the workbook structure of an old excel file to access 0 hidden sheets, not 1 very hidden. Forgot excel workbook structure protected password normally, it.
If you dont supply a password, then any user can unprotect the. The workbook structure is protected i want to be able to unprotect the book, make one sheet visable and then make the sheet that was previously visible hidden, then protect the book again. Specifically, i would like to do this in vba, because eventually i want to be able to do this to multiple files using a loop. Unprotect all worksheets in workbook using vba example. My vba code that someone helped me write im learningtransfers the data from the input form to the database, but it wont do it with the worksheet workbook protection on. Do you want to protect sheets or workbook structure in a secure way that cannot be hacked by a vba brute force attack running in excel 20072010. Ive used the below code to unprotect the individual sheets in my excell 20 workbook. We can protect the workbook structure which will allow users to open the file but prevent them from rearranging, renaming, updating, deleting or creating new worksheets without a password. Each excel workbook contains of a bunch of folders and xml files. If you chose the structure box, then nobody can mess around with the sheets in the workbook like deleting or rearranging. Unprotect excel workbook tips to unprotect an excel workbook. Unprotect microsoft excel workbook sheet 2016 without password.
It works for me just fine in excel 2010 but i am not sure if it will work in 20. How to protect and unprotect workbook structure and. Sep 21, 2017 protecting the structure or the windows thisworkbook. After typing the workbook structure password, you can easily unprotect excel 20 workbook easily. Vba code to password protect workbook excel general. This example removes protection from the active workbook. Sep 19, 2016 remove password from excel workbook sheet microsoft office 2007, 2010, 20, 2016 easy no macro or no external softwares.
Unprotect all worksheets in workbook using vba solution. There is also free vba macro that can help you remove protection on your workbook structure. Remove password from excel workbook sheet microsoft office 2007, 2010, 20, 2016 easy no macro or no external softwares. Enter the unprotect password on the text box and click on ok. We can unprotect all worksheets in workbook using vba. To prevent other users from viewing hidden worksheets, adding, moving, deleting, or. Unprotect password password but this does absolutely nothing. Nov 14, 2019 to unprotect excel sheet without password in the modern versions of excel 2019, excel 2016 and excel 20, you can save the document as excel 972003 workbook. How to unprotect excel workbook and worksheet with or. To prevent other users from removing workbook protection, in the password optional box, type a password, click ok, and then retype the password to confirm it. Unprotectpassword password but this does absolutely nothing. Unprotect a workbook using excel and vba exceldome.
When the unprotect workbook small box pops up, enter the password to unprotect workbook structure. How to protect worksheets and unprotect excel sheet without. To unprotect excel sheet without password in the modern versions of excel 2019, excel 2016 and excel 20, you can save the document as excel 972003 workbook. How to unprotect excel workbooksheet without password. To unprotect to password protected workbook follow below given steps. You can call this macro from some other macro if u dont want to go to vba and run it. How to unprotect excel sheetworksheetworkbook without password. Vba workbook protection allows you to lock the structure of the workbook. A better way to run macros in a protected worksheet would be to use the userinterfaceonly argument in the protect method, by setting the userinterfaceonly argument to true, in the manner. For the same, well go to file info protect workbook protect workbook structure as shown below. Again you have to enter the password for write access in the workbook. This tutorial will show you how to protect or unprotect workbook structure using vba. Worksheet protection is defined in a specific tag into xml file.
How to unprotect excel sheetworkbook with vba codes as you have read, it is very easy to unprotect excel sheet using a thirdparty tool like excel password recovery but there are also other efficient methods available that you can implement on your locked excel document. Unprotect a workbook how to unprotect an excel workbook structure using excel or vba. The vba codes helps to unprotect excel workbook 2010 and earlier. Make sure all of the code is copied into your vba project. Then, close excel and reopen the workbook it will be opened in compatibility mode.
1298 1164 1183 187 363 899 1094 484 1277 1137 654 1337 530 1109 1328 236 1 655 1151 408 1203 1488 250 1311 339 768 274 570 1138 915 1252 1246 410 97 1146 861 681 134 1378 343 1086 1367